Background of Google’s Pixel Phones
Launched in 2016, the Google Pixel line has become synonymous with high-quality cameras and seamless integration with Google’s software ecosystem. Initially, the production of these devices was heavily reliant on Chinese manufacturers, which provided both the hardware and assembly services necessary to bring the Pixel to market. Over the years, the Pixel brand has evolved, garnering a loyal customer base and establishing itself as a competitor to other flagship smartphones.
However, the reliance on China for manufacturing has posed challenges for Google, particularly in light of geopolitical tensions and supply chain disruptions. The COVID-19 pandemic further exacerbated these issues, leading to delays and increased costs. As a result, Google has been exploring alternative manufacturing locations to mitigate risks and ensure a more stable supply chain.
Reasons for the Shift to Vietnam
The decision to move Pixel development and production to Vietnam is influenced by several factors:
- Geopolitical Tensions: The ongoing trade tensions between the United States and China have created an uncertain environment for companies operating in China. Tariffs and restrictions have prompted many tech firms to reconsider their manufacturing strategies.
- Supply Chain Resilience: The pandemic highlighted vulnerabilities in global supply chains. By diversifying manufacturing locations, Google aims to enhance its resilience against future disruptions.
- Cost Efficiency: Vietnam offers a competitive labor market and lower production costs compared to China. This shift could lead to significant savings for Google, allowing the company to invest more in research and development.

Broader Industry Trends
Google’s decision to move Pixel development and production to Vietnam reflects a broader trend within the tech industry. Many companies are reevaluating their supply chains and exploring new manufacturing locations in response to geopolitical tensions and the lessons learned from the pandemic.
Other Companies Following Suit
Several major tech companies have already begun diversifying their manufacturing bases. For instance, Apple has been increasing its production in countries like India and Vietnam to reduce its reliance on China. This trend is likely to continue as companies seek to mitigate risks and enhance their operational flexibility.
Vietnam’s Growing Role in Tech Manufacturing
Vietnam has positioned itself as a viable alternative for tech manufacturing, attracting investments from various global companies. The country’s government has implemented policies to support foreign investment and improve infrastructure, making it an attractive destination for manufacturers. As more companies follow Google’s lead, Vietnam’s role in the global tech supply chain is expected to grow.
